Question:

In the following question find out the alternative which will replace the question mark?

Poles : Magnet :: ? : Battery

Options:

Cells

Power

Terminals 

Energy

Correct Answer:

Terminals 

Explanation:

The answer is Terminals.

The analogy is between the poles of a magnet and the terminals of a battery. The poles of a magnet are the points where the magnetic field is strongest, and the terminals of a battery are the points where the electrical current flows in and out of the battery. So, the missing word must be the points where the electrical current flows in and out of a battery. Of the answer choices, only terminals fits this description.
